Manufacturing

US and North American solar manufacturing have potential to rise significantly as both Sen. Jon Ossoff’s Solar Energy Manufacturing for America Act and the Biden Administration’s Build Back Better (BBB) Act, which has $550 billion in climate provisions, work their way through the legislature.

An earlier proposal of BBB had significant provisions for US manufacturing. Included in the bill were incentives for the manufacture of thin film PV or crystalline PV cells. The incentive would pay $0.04 per watt DC capacity of the cell. PV wafers would be offered $12 per square meter, and solar-grade polysilicon is offered $3 per kilogram US-made solar modules are offered an incentive of $0.07 per watt.

Senator Joe Manchin (D-VA) shut down the earlier proposal of BBB, and said he intends to start “from scratch,” but it is likely that US manufacturing would continue to receive focus in the Act.

An industry can develop sustainably only if it has a comprehensive vision of its supply chain. Europe has divested from the most strategic steps of the solar PV value chain, and most of the EU project developers rely on a limited number of suppliers, with significant concentration in a limited number of countries outside Europe. The European solar industry has flourished in the past years thanks to a fruitful cooperation with these global partners, and there is no sign that such a cooperation will stop tomorrow.

Nevertheless, in the medium term, this raises questions about the impact on the EU solar industry. Future disturbances in the supply chain, such as the current increase of shipping costs, the 400% increase of polysilicon costs or the expected shortage of solar PV modules supply in 2022, could cause temporary yet costly stress and delays in module procurement and project development. This is detrimental to the speed of European decarbonisation. Allowing access to a diversified supply of components in the medium term is necessary to ensure a healthy competition among manufacturers, sustain a continuous innovation cycle, improve the sustainability of the supply chain and strengthen the resilience of the industry in case of future shocks.

Worldwide Silicon Wafer Shipments and Revenue Set New Records in 2021, SEMI Reports

MILPITAS, Calif. — February 8, 2022 — Worldwide silicon wafer area shipments in 2021 increased 14% while wafer revenue rose 13% compared to 2020, topping $12 billion, to reach new all-time highs, the SEMI Silicon Manufacturers Group (SMG) reported in its year-end analysis of the silicon wafer industry.

Silicon shipments totaled 14,165 million square inches (MSI) compared to 12,407 MSI shipped in 2020 to meet surging broad-based demand for semiconductor devices and a wide variety of applications. 300mm, 200mm and 150mm wafer sizes all saw strong demand. Wafer revenue reached $12,617 million, surpassing the previous record of $12,129 million set in 2007.

“The robust year-over-year growth in silicon wafer area shipments and revenue reflects the heavy dependence of the modern economy on silicon wafers,” said Neil Weaver, outgoing chairman SEMI SMG 2018-2021 and vice president, Product Development and Applications Engineering at Shin Etsu Handotai America. “Wafers are the engine of digital transformation and new technologies that are reshaping how we live and work.”

STATEMENT BY US SECRETARY OF LABOR WALSH ON INTERNATIONAL LABOUR ORGANIZATION REPORT CITING SERIOUS SITUATION IN XINJIANG
WASHINGTON – U.S. Secretary of Labor Marty Walsh issued the following statement on the International Labour Organization’s Committee of Experts on the Application of Conventions and Recommendations report:

“The International Labour Organization on Wednesday shined a spotlight on the serious situation and human rights abuses taking place in Xinjiang, China. The ILO’s Committee of Experts on the Application of Conventions and Recommendations, in its annual report on countries’ compliance with international labor standards, expressed “deep concern” regarding the People’s Republic of China’s policies towards the Uyghur and other mostly Muslim minorities in Chinas far western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region.

“The Committee of Experts on the Application of Conventions and Recommendations requested that the PRC’s government take steps to promote equal employment opportunity and treatment without discrimination based on race, national extraction, religion or political opinion; and revise national and regional polices that use vocational training and rehabilitation centers for political re-education based on administrative detention.

“The Department of Labor calls on the PRC to take the steps requested by the Committee of Experts, and to end its abuses of the predominantly Muslim Uyghurs and members of other ethnic and religious minority groups in Xinjiang, as well as its use of these groups for forced labor in Xinjiang and beyond.

“The Department of Labor is committed to empowering workers at home and abroad, including by uncovering and combating forced labor in all its forms. Our reporting on forced labor identified ten products made with forced labor in Xinjiang, including cotton, textiles, tomatoes, hair products and polysilicon. Many trusted sources confirm that the People’s Republic has arbitrarily detained more than one million Uyghurs and other mostly Muslim minorities in Xinjiang. An estimated 100,000 Uyghurs and other ethnic minority ex-detainees in China may be working in conditions of forced labor following detention in re-education camps.”

WASHINGTON, D.C. — The U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) today issued two notices of intent to provide $2.91 billion to boost production of the advanced batteries that are critical to rapidly growing clean energy industries of the future, including electric vehicles and energy storage, as directed by the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law. The Department intends to fund battery materials refining and production plants, battery cell and pack manufacturing facilities, and recycling facilities that create good-paying clean energy jobs. The funding is expected to be made available in the coming months and will ensure that the United States can produce batteries, as well as the materials that go into them, to increase economic competitiveness, energy independence, and national security.
